Transaction 43635a470c515af8102d35bc8d17aaff9838a0dda0d7b5a31dae035bd97acc61
1 Input
1 Output
-
43635a470c515af8102d35bc8d17aaff9838a0dda0d7b5a31dae035bd97acc61:0
- value
- 321316
- script pubkey
- OP_0 OP_PUSHBYTES_20 adae18da1396d911ce53a0aa49c5280316799f5b
- address
- bc1q4khp3ksnjmv3rnjn5z4yn3fgqvt8n86mw90n6a